Number Theory

   

Geometric Theorems, Diophantine Equations, and Arithmetic Functions

Authors: József Sándor

This book contains short notes or articles, as well as studies on several topics of Geometry and Number theory. The material is divided into five chapters: Geometric theorems; Diophantine equations; Arithmetic functions; Divisibility properties of numbers and functions; and Some irrationality results. Chapter 1 deals essentially with geometric inequalities for the remarkable elements of triangles or tetrahedrons. Other themes have an arithmetic character (as 9-12) on number theoretic problems in Geometry
